New Subaru Electric Vehicles Showcase High Performance and Practical Features for 2026-2027
Subaru is expanding its electric vehicle lineup with two new models offering substantial power and capability.
The 2027 Subaru Getaway is an all-electric three-row SUV with 420 horsepower and standard all-wheel drive, positioning itself as the company's most powerful vehicle ever.

"Subaru is rolling out its most powerful vehicle ever, an all-electric three-row SUV with 420 horsepower, standard all-wheel drive and off-road capability."
The 2026 Subaru Trail Seeker, priced at $41,000 before discounts, offers 280 miles of range and can tow 3,500 pounds, making it practical for both daily driving and recreational use.
